PaywallEvent

@Serializable
data class PaywallEvent(val creationData: PaywallEvent.CreationData, val data: PaywallEvent.Data, val type: PaywallEventType)

Type representing a paywall event and associated data. Meant for RevenueCatUI use.

Constructors

Link copied to clipboard
constructor(creationData: PaywallEvent.CreationData, data: PaywallEvent.Data, type: PaywallEventType)

Types

Link copied to clipboard
@Serializable
data class CreationData(val id: UUID, val date: Date)
Link copied to clipboard
@Serializable
data class Data(val offeringIdentifier: String, val paywallRevision: Int, val sessionIdentifier: UUID, val displayMode: String, val localeIdentifier: String, val darkMode: Boolean)

Properties

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ard